The best time to visit the Caribbean largely depends on your preferences and priorities:
Dry Season (December - April): This is the peak tourist season, characterised by warm, sunny weather. However, you'll also find higher prices and crowded attractions during this time.
Wet Season (June - November): This period sees more rainfall and is also the hurricane season. The upside is that it's less crowded, and you can find some great deals on accommodation and flights. But, if you choose to visit during this time, always check the weather forecast and stay updated on potential hurricanes.

The Caribbean is an archipelago of numerous islands, each with its unique charm. Here are some top highlights:
The Pitons, St. Lucia: Twin volcanic spires that are a UNESCO World Heritage site. Hiking these mountains or simply admiring them from afar is a must.
Old Havana, Cuba: Time seems to have frozen in this vibrant city with its colonial-era architecture and classic cars.
Harrison's Cave, Barbados: A crystallised limestone cavern with flowing streams and deep pools – a natural wonder worth exploring.
Dunn's River Falls, Jamaica: An astounding waterfall and popular tourist attraction. Climb the falls for a thrilling adventure.
Local Currency: While many places accept US dollars, it's good to have some local currency for small purchases.
Sun Protection: The Caribbean sun can be intense. Always carry sunscreen, sunglasses, and a wide-brimmed hat.
Stay Hydrated: Drink lots of water, and remember, while the local rum is delicious, it's easy to overindulge!
Local Etiquette: Respect local customs and traditions. In many places, it's frowned upon to wear swimwear away from the beach.
Travel Insurance: With any international travel, ensure you have comprehensive travel insurance.
This can vary widely based on the island, type of accommodation, and activities you choose. On average, for a mid-range experience:
Flights: £2,000 - £3,500
Accommodation (7 nights): £1,200 - £2,500
Food and Dining: £600 - £1,000
Activities and Excursions: £500 - £1,000
Miscellaneous (shopping, additional transport): £300 - £600
Total Average Budget: £4,600 - £8,600
Remember, these are just average figures. There are ways to holiday in the Caribbean on a shoestring, and equally, luxury options can cost substantially more.
